Tokyo (AP) — Latest information on the Tokyo Olympics, which is being held under strict restrictions one year later due to the coronavirus pandemic:

German cyclist Simon Geschke was excluded from the men’s road race after a positive coronavirus test.
The German team says Geschke first tested positive on Friday and his results were confirmed by another test later that day.
Germany said fellow riders Nikias Arndt and Maximilian Schachmann were allowed to race on Saturday. Emanuel Buchmann, the team’s fourth rider, was Geschke’s roommate, waiting overnight for the results of another PCR test for the virus. The team staff was negative on the test.
Geschke was the 2015 Tour de France stage winner.
German road racing teams live in hotels, not in the Olympic Village.
Geschke says he followed the Olympic hygiene rules. “I’m physically fine, but emotionally it’s a really terrible day,” he adds.
